MO-1 Incorrect USB Driver for Image Mate 3
In certain case the MO-1 is not properly assigned driver by Windows. This will cause Image Mate to fail in detecting your MO-1 camera.
Step 1: Have your MO-1 turned on and connected to your computer via USB.
Step 2: In the start menu select Devices and Printers
Step 3: Right click your MO-1 and select properties
Step 4: Select the Hardware tab, then double click MO-1 Audio Device
Step 5: Select the driver tab and press Uninstall.
You will need to repeat Step 4 and Step 5 for the “Video Camera Device” and “USB Composite Device” as well. Once all three have been un-installed you will need to reboot your computer.
Be sure to disconnect the MO-1 before rebooting. Once the computer has finished rebooting, connect your MO-1 via the USB cable and power on the camera. Windows will detect the new device and assign the drivers. Once Windows has finished the driver installation you can start Image Mate.
